    World Car of the Year finalists

    The countdown for the 2010 World Car and World Performance Car of the Year has begun. Results of the prestigious award will be out on April 1, 2010, at a press conference held at the New York International Auto Show.

    A jury of 59 international automotive journalists have already selected the top ten cars in both the categories and the top 3 finalist in all award categories will be announced at the Geneva Motor Show on March 2, 2010.

    The judges have discreetly voted their candidate via secret ballot on the basis of their individual experience with each vehicle. Following meticulous tabulation, the top 10 finalists from both the categories were selected. All the jury members - hold significant stature - constitute a balance of representation from Asia, Europe, North America, South America, as well as other parts of the world.

    The jurors will now re-evaluate the top ten cars in both classes, and re-vote in February. They will specifically rate each vehicle in terms of overall merit, value, safety, environmental responsibility, emotional appeal, and significance. These votes will be tabulated again and the top three finalists in both the categories will be announced.

    Finalists in the remaining two categories – World Car Design and World Green Car - are handled differently. A separate panel of five highly respected world design experts will assist the judges and will develop a short list of recommendations constituting the finalists from the 2010 World Car of the Year list. The judges will then choose the winner of the 2010 World Car Design of the Year from the recommended list. Same procedures are followed for the World Green Car* award as well.

    Intended to complement the existing national and regional Car of the Year awards, the World Car Awards have become the world’s most prestigious and credible programme. Inaugurated in 2003, and officially launched in January 2004, the motive behind this award is to reflect the reality of the global marketplace, as well as to recognize and reward automotive excellence on an international scale.

    The 2010 World Car of the Year will be selected from the following top cars:
    Audi Q5
    BMW X1 
    Chevrolet Cruze
    Kia Soul       
    Mazda3 
    Mercedes-Benz E-Class  
    Opel/Vauxhall Insignia / Buick Regal   
    Porsche Panamera       
    Toyota Prius   
    Volkswagen Polo
     
    The 2010 World Performance Car will be chosen from the following top ten finalists:
    Aston Martin V12 Vantage       
    Audi R8 V10    
    Audi TT RS Coupé / Roadster    
    BMW Z4 
    Ferrari California     
    Jaguar XFR     
    Lotus Evora    
    Mercedes-Be nz E 63 AMG 
    Nissan 370 Z   
    Porsche 911 GT3
    Porsche Boxster / Cayman
